three sum

#array, #medium, #twopointers, #sorting, link to problem ↗

we will be using two pointers coming in from the opposite direction, fixing one number will make it a two sum problem. since the index doesn’t need to be preserved, just sort it.

def threeSum(self, nums: list[int]) -> list[list[int]]:
myset = set()
i = 0
n = len(nums)
nums = sorted(nums)
while i < n-2:
l = i+1
r = n-1
while l < r:
val = nums[i] + nums[l] + nums[r]
if val == 0:
myset.add((nums[i], nums[l], nums[r])) #tuples
l+=1
r-=1
elif val<0:
l+=1
else:
r-=1
i+=1
triplets = []
for val in myset:
triplets.append(list(val)) #tuples to list
return triplets
def threeSum(self, nums: list[int]) -> list[list[int]]:
triplets = []
nums.sort()
n=len(nums)
for i in range(n-2):
#skip duplicates for i
if i>0 and nums[i]==nums[i-1]:
continue
l=i+1
r=n-1
while l<r:
val = nums[i] + nums[l] + nums[r]
if val == 0:
triplets.append([nums[i], nums[l], nums[r]])
l += 1
r -= 1
# skip duplicates for l
while l<r and nums[l] == nums[l-1]:
l+=1
# skip duplicates for r
while l<r and nums[r] == nums[r+1]:
r-=1
elif val<0:
l+=1
else:
r-=1
return triplets
